Ayatollah Ali Khamenei Funeral Draws Massive Crowds in Tehran

Iran began a week-long state funeral for Ayatollah Ali Khamenei as thousands gathered in Tehran amid heightened regional tensions and diplomatic uncertainty.

DUBAI: The Ayatollah Ali Khamenei funeral drew tens of thousands of mourners to Tehran on Saturday as Iran launched an elaborate week-long state mourning programme following the death of the country’s supreme leader during the recent conflict involving the United States and Israel. The public ceremony was held at the Imam Khomeini Grand Mosalla, where mourners gathered to pay their respects amid tight security and emotional displays of grief.

The funeral marks a defining moment for Iran’s political and religious leadership, with authorities portraying the ceremonies as a symbol of national unity while the country navigates a sensitive post-war period.

Ayatollah Ali Khamenei Funeral Begins Week-Long State Ceremonies

Following an initial lying-in-state ceremony attended by senior Iranian leaders and foreign dignitaries, Khamenei’s coffin was placed on public display alongside those of several members of his family.

Key developments include:

  • Tens of thousands attended the funeral gathering in Tehran.
  • Iran has planned funeral processions in Tehran, Qom, Najaf, Karbala and Mashhad over the coming days.
  • Authorities have arranged transport, food and accommodation to facilitate large public participation.
  • Senior political and military leaders attended the state ceremonies.

Iranian authorities have described the funeral as a national event honouring the country’s highest political and religious authority.

The funeral comes at a crucial time for Iran following weeks of military confrontation and an interim ceasefire agreement. Alongside the religious significance of the ceremonies, the event is expected to influence the country’s political transition and regional diplomacy.

The second-order impact could extend beyond Iran’s domestic politics. Leadership changes, ongoing diplomatic efforts and security developments in the Persian Gulf may affect regional stability, global energy markets and future negotiations involving Iran and Western countries.

Meanwhile, diplomatic uncertainty continues. While mediation efforts involving regional countries remain active, statements from both Iranian and US officials indicate that discussions surrounding the ceasefire and broader agreements remain complex. The funeral period is also expected to shape the timing and direction of future diplomatic engagement.

Authorities have called for large public participation throughout the week as ceremonies continue in several religious and cultural centres before Ayatollah Ali Khamenei’s final burial.
